You are hiring the first Product Manager for a new product area that will drive a strategic initiative next year. Describe the end-to-end approach you would use to: 1) define the role and success metrics, 2) create a competency checklist, 3) design the interview loop and stakeholders involved, and 4) make a hiring decision that balances cultural fit and product expertise.
Sample Answer
Situation: I was asked to hire the first Product Manager for a new strategic product area that must deliver measurable impact next year.
Task: My goal was to design an end-to-end hiring process that defines the role, measures success, verifies competencies, runs an effective interview loop with the right stakeholders, and balances culture fit with product expertise.
Action:
- Define role & success metrics
- Wrote a one-page role brief linking responsibilities to business outcomes (e.g., drive $X ARR, launch N features, improve NPS by Y points).
- Set 30/60/90 objectives: discovery & backlog alignment (30), MVP delivery (60), measurable adoption/ops improvements (90).
- Success metrics: OKRs tied to adoption, retention, time-to-market, stakeholder satisfaction.
- Create competency checklist
- Split into three buckets: product craft (discovery, roadmap, metrics), execution (project management, technical fluency), and soft skills (stakeholder influence, communication, customer empathy).
- For each, defined behavioral indicators at hire: example—“leads user interviews and translates into prioritized backlog” and evidence to collect.
- Design interview loop & stakeholders
- Screen (recruiter) for role fit and motivation.
- Product exercise (take-home + 45m presentation) to evaluate problem framing, user empathy, and trade-offs.
- Technical/collaboration interview with engineering lead to assess technical judgment and delivery approach.
- PM behavioral interview with hiring manager to probe leadership, stakeholder management.
- Go/no-go cross-functional panel with design, marketing, and customer success to validate culture and launch-readiness.
- Include a reference check focusing on execution and impact.
- Hiring decision balancing culture & expertise
- Use a rubric mapping competencies to scores; require minimum on “values fit” and “core product skills.”
- Discuss trade-offs in debrief: if high skills but lower cultural alignment, plan onboarding and mentorship; if great culture but gaps in critical skills, assess trainability and short-term support (e.g., senior PM mentorship).
- Make decision based on evidence, alignment to 90-day goals, and risk mitigation plan.
Result: This approach produces objective decisions, shortens time-to-hire, and increases confidence that the PM can deliver early strategic milestones while fitting the company culture.
Design a 30-60-90 day onboarding plan for a new product manager joining a mid-stage SaaS company (12-person product org). Include objectives for each phase, stakeholders to meet, artifacts to review (roadmap, analytics, RFCs), sample early deliverables, and measurable success criteria for manager, new-hire, and team.
Sample Answer
30-day (Learn & Observe)
Objectives:
- Rapidly understand product, customers, metrics, processes, and culture.
Stakeholders to meet: - PM lead, VP Product, engineering manager, QA lead, Sales AE, Customer Success, Marketing, data analyst.
Artifacts to review: - Current roadmap, OKRs, recent RFCs, PRDs, backlog, analytics dashboards (DAU/MAU, conversion, churn), customer interview notes, support tickets.
Sample early deliverables: - 1-page onboarding summary with risks/opportunities, top 5 questions, and suggested quick wins.
Measurable success: - Manager: confirms completion of stakeholder 1:1s and artifacts review.
- New-hire: can present product landscape and top 3 customer pain points.
- Team: new PM integrated into standups and planning.
60-day (Contribute & Experiment)
Objectives:
- Take ownership of a small area, validate hypotheses with data/customers, propose prioritized work.
Stakeholders to meet: - Cross-functional squad, two key customers, finance for monetization inputs.
Artifacts to review: - A/B experiment history, technical constraints docs, roadmap prioritization criteria.
Sample early deliverables: - Draft RFC for a scoped feature or experiment, success metrics, and implementation timeline.
Measurable success: - Manager: approves RFC and coaching checkpoints met.
- New-hire: runs 3 customer interviews and an analytics deep-dive.
- Team: backlog updated with clear acceptance criteria for the new initiative.
90-day (Deliver & Align)
Objectives:
- Drive feature through to launch/experiment, measure impact, and refine longer-term roadmap contribution.
Stakeholders to meet: - Executives for roadmap alignment, customer advisory participants, Ops for launch readiness.
Artifacts to review: - Launch playbook, post-launch review templates, roadmap for next two quarters.
Sample early deliverables: - Finalized PRD/RFC, launch checklist completed, dashboard showing experiment/feature results, post-mortem with learnings and next steps.
Measurable success: - Manager: feature delivered or experiment executed with outcome review; clear development of independent ownership.
- New-hire: demonstrates impact — metric improvement or validated learnings; prioritized roadmap input accepted.
- Team: reduced ambiguity in backlog, improved sprint predictability, and positive feedback in 90-day review.
General notes:
- Success metrics should be specific and measurable (e.g., +10% conversion, 20 customer interviews, RFC approved within 30 days).
- Keep weekly 1:1s, a 30/60/90 checkpoint with manager, and a blameless post-launch review to close the loop.
Half of your feature delivery is executed by external contractors. Propose a governance model to onboard, manage, and align contractors with product vision. Include SLAs, acceptance criteria, quality checks, communication cadence, cultural alignment practices, and how to capture knowledge when contracts end.
Sample Answer
Situation: We outsource ~50% of feature delivery to contractors and need a governance model that ensures alignment with product vision, quality, and continuity when contracts end.
Proposal (overview): Create a Contractor Governance Framework covering onboarding, ongoing management, quality & acceptance, communication cadence, cultural alignment, SLAs, and offboarding/knowledge capture.
- Onboarding (first 2 weeks)
- Contract + responsibilities: role, deliverables, SLAs, security/NDAs, IP.
- Operational setup: access to repos, CI/CD, analytics, design system, templates (JIRA, PR, Confluence).
- Product context: 1-hour product vision briefing, goals/OKRs, prioritized roadmaps, user personas, success metrics.
- Pairing: assign internal buddy (PM or senior engineer) for 4 weeks.
- Checklist tracked in Confluence; kickoff demo scheduled.
- SLAs & KPIs
- Delivery SLA: sprint commitments (e.g., deliver N story points per sprint) + on-time % target.
- Quality SLAs: max escape rate (e.g., <=1 critical production bug/month), test coverage threshold, code review turnaround <=48h.
- Support SLAs: response time for incidents (P1: 1h, P2: 4h, P3: 24h).
- Business KPIs: feature adoption, conversion lift, performance metrics tied to product goals.
- Penalties/incentives: phased payments, bonus for meeting KPIs, remediation plans for SLA misses.
- Acceptance criteria & quality checks
- Every story must include clear acceptance criteria mapped to user outcomes (given/when/then), UX specs, performance targets.
- Definition of Done: unit tests, integration tests, CI pass, code review, security scan, automated linting, documentation updated.
- Gate checks: automated pipelines + pre-merge checks, QA sign-off on test cases, UAT with PM before release.
- Periodic code audits and architecture reviews (monthly or per major release).
- Communication cadence
- Weekly: sprint planning & backlog grooming with contractors + internal team.
- Twice-weekly: standups integrated into team cadence (or written updates).
- Bi-weekly: sprint demo + acceptance walkthrough with stakeholders; record demos.
- Monthly: performance review against SLAs and KPIs; risk review.
- Quarterly: roadmap alignment & retrospective involving contractor leads.
- Tools: Slack channels (tagged), JIRA for tickets, Confluence for docs, shared dashboards (Datadog/GAnalytics).
- Cultural alignment & collaboration
- Include contractors in team rituals (retrospectives, demos).
- Share product mission, user stories, customer interviews.
- Onboarding cultural brief: communication norms, code style, and decision-making process.
- Encourage knowledge sharing: brown-bags, shared design critiques.
- Evaluate fit during probation and provide coaching.
- Knowledge capture & offboarding
- Continuous documentation: every feature must have a Confluence spec, architecture diagram, runbook, and release notes.
- Code ownership map and docs stored in a central repo.
- Pairing & shadowing: internal engineers pair on critical modules throughout contract.
- Handover sprint (2–4 weeks) before contract end: contractor performs walkthroughs, executes migration tasks, and resolves outstanding issues.
- Final deliverables: up-to-date tests, CI config, deployment playbook, and a short recorded walkthrough.
- Post-contract audit: verify docs, runbook tests, and optional short extension for bug fixes.
Why this works
- Balances autonomy with accountability: clear SLAs + acceptance criteria.
- Reduces bus factor via pairing and continuous documentation.
- Keeps product alignment via regular demos and KPI tracking.
- Enables remediation and learning through structured reviews and retros.
Example metrics to monitor
- On-time delivery rate, defect escape rate, mean time to acknowledge/resolve incidents, feature adoption lift, documentation completeness score.
This model is adjustable by project criticality: raise SLAs and pairing intensity for core platform work; use lighter governance for low-risk features.
Design a 90-day onboarding program for cross-functional new hires (PM, engineer, designer) joining a product team. Include objectives by day 30/60/90, specific activities (shadowing, docs, projects), success criteria, and how you would coordinate the onboarding experience with HR and engineering managers.
Sample Answer
Requirements & principles:
- Goal: accelerate time-to-contribution, align cross-functional context, and create shared product ownership.
- Assumptions: 1 product team (PM, 3 eng, 1–2 designers), access to product docs, staging env, mentor assigned.
Day 0–30 (Learn & Observe)
Objectives:
- Understand product vision, metrics, user problems, team processes.
Activities: - HR: complete paperwork, benefits, and culture orientation.
- Pairing: 1:1 with PM, Tech Lead, Design Lead; shadow daily standups, backlog grooming, design critiques.
- Read: product spec, roadmap, OKRs, analytics dashboards, recent postmortems.
- Hands-on: run local dev, deploy sample PR; complete a small “first-issue” ticket.
Success criteria: - Can summarize product vision, top 3 metrics, and current sprint scope; merged first small PR or design microtask.
Day 31–60 (Contribute & Iterate)
Objectives:
- Start owning a slice of work and improve cross-functional collaboration.
Activities: - Lead a small feature or experiment (PM: draft PRD; Eng: implement backend/frontend; Designer: deliver mockups & prototype).
- Continued mentorship: weekly sync with manager, biweekly stakeholder demo.
- Training: analytics tooling, user-research shadowing, security/release process.
Success criteria: - Deliver incremental outcome (MVP or A/B test), clear stakeholder feedback, ticket throughput matches team baseline.
Day 61–90 (Own & Optimize)
Objectives:
- Independently drive a meaningful roadmap item end-to-end and propose improvements.
Activities: - Own end-to-end release: define success metrics, coordinate dev/design/QA, run launch checklist, monitor post-launch metrics.
- Run a retrospective on onboarding and present suggested process improvements.
- Career check-in with HR and manager; set 6–12 month goals.
Success criteria: - Successfully shipped feature/experiment with measured impact (metric delta or validated learning), positive 360 feedback on collaboration.
Coordination with HR & Engineering Managers
- Pre-boarding: HR sends schedule, access requests; hiring manager/PM prepares tailored learning plan and assigns mentor.
- Weekly syncs first 8 weeks between PM, Eng Manager, HR to track ramp, unblock permissions, and adjust training.
- Managers own role-specific milestones; HR owns culture, paperwork, and cross-team orientation; PM coordinates the product-context activities and ensures cross-functional shadowing.
- Use shared onboarding tracker (Jira/Notion) with milestones, owners, and success criteria; held to a 30/60/90 review cadence.
Risks & mitigations
- Overload: limit to 2 learning streams per week; prioritize "learn-by-doing".
- Access delays: escalate via manager and HR pre-boarding checklist.
- Misalignment: early stakeholder demo and fortnightly checkpoints.
Your org relies on a single payments-security expert who is critical to several roadmaps. Propose a retention and resilience plan that includes succession steps, mentoring and knowledge transfer, vendor/contractor backup strategy, on-call coverage, and KPIs to ensure continuity and reduce single-point-of-failure risk within six months.
Sample Answer
Situation: We rely on one payments-security SME who is critical to multiple roadmaps — a clear single-point-of-failure risk.
Plan (6-month timeline, owner: Product Manager with Engineering & People Ops):
Month 0–1: Assessment & immediate protections
- Map responsibilities, systems, docs, vendors, and critical roadmaps the SME touches.
- Create an RACI for payments-security tasks.
- Hire a short-term contractor (or escalate existing vendor SLAs) to provide immediate backup coverage during ramp.
Month 1–3: Succession + knowledge-transfer
- Pair the SME with two designated deputies (one senior engineer, one security engineer). Formalize 2x 2-hour/week shadowing sessions.
- Run weekly documented walkthroughs: threat model reviews, deployment checklist, incident playbooks, PCI/PSP compliance steps. Record sessions.
- Convert tribal knowledge into a living runbook in the team wiki (architecture diagrams, configuration, keys rotation, vendor contacts).
Month 2–4: Mentoring & skill development
- Create 3-month learning curriculum (courses, hands-on labs, tabletop exercises) for deputies. Sponsor vendor-certifications (e.g., PCI, relevant payment provider).
- Require deputies to own at least one low-risk deployment under SME supervision.
Month 3–6: Operational resilience & vendor strategy
- Formalize vendor/contractor backup: pre-approved contractor list, negotiated short-term augmentation clauses, and a second vendor as failover for core payment gateway.
- Implement on-call rotation: 2-person primary rota (deputy + SME) with a secondary vendor/contractor escalation path. Define SLA tiers and runbook-trigger thresholds.
- Introduce automated alerts and playbooks (incident templates, runbook automation).
KPIs (tracked weekly/monthly)
- Knowledge coverage score: percent of runbook topics with deputy ownership (target 90% by month 4).
- Deputies competency: pass-rate on practical exercises (target 100% by month 6).
- Mean time to acknowledge (MTTA) and mean time to resolve (MTTR) for payments incidents (reduce MTTR by 30% in 6 months).
- On-call coverage SLA adherence (99% response within defined SLA).
- Vendor failover test success rate (quarterly; 100% successful in simulated failover by month 6).
- Roadmap velocity metric: % of payment-features delivered on time with deputy ownership (no drop vs baseline).
Risks & trade-offs
- Short-term cost for contractors/certifications vs long-term risk reduction.
- Balance SME time between mentorship and delivery; protect mentoring time in capacity planning.
Outcome: Within six months we move from a single-person dependency to a documented, trained, and operationally supported payments-security capability with measurable KPIs and vendor backups.
